On any given saturday, LALANNE FITNESS holds what appears to be an athletic event called a 'challenge'. These challenges are an opportunity for our entire community to measure their improvement. Prizes are awarded to the fastest and most improved times over an eight week period. Congratulations to all 25 students who showed up this past saturday. The FRAN CHALLENGE is on! TABATA THIS!
The Tabata interval is 20 seconds of
work, followed by 10 seconds of
rest, repeated for 8 sets. Complete
one Tabata interval for each
exercise, with a one-minute recovery
between exercises.
Row
Squat
Pull-up
Push-up
Sit-up
Your score is the sum total of the
lowest scores in each interval. The
order of the exercises can be
changed.

Living in the Zone

The one hour you spend each day training is not nearly as important as what you do in the other 23 hours of the day. Specifically, I am talking about what you put into your mouth! Your body is your machine and it needs the proper fuel to keep going. Doing CrossFit alone will lean you out, but using the Zone Diet Principles created by Barry Sears in conjunction with your training will take you to another level! Elite athletes do not poison their body with junk food, the foundation of athlete development is nutrition. Make quality protein a priority, add low glycemic-load carbohydrates, then good fats. Elite Fitness is a ‘ready’ state!

Elite Fitness is an athletic ability or a 'ready' state in which one is capable of performing relatively well at any physical task thrown his way. Load a hopper with athletic tasks and the better athlete is able to do more of them better than the other guy. CrossFit is designed for this type of general physical preparation. Nature, on average, punishes the specialist. The more specialized you are the less cross-adapted you are likely to be in other measures of physical prowess. The CrossFit athlete is better able to deal with a variety of athletic demands than the athlete training with other fitness modalities.
